A point in the figure is selected at random. Find the probability that the point will be in the shaded region.

A. about 25%
B. about 60%
C. about 50%
D. about 75%

Answer:

B. about 60%

Explanation:

Let us assume that the radius of the semi-circle is d units.

So the area of the semi-circle will be,


=(\pi d^2)/(2)

In total there are 4 semi circles, so the net area will be,


=4* (\pi d^2)/(2)


=2\pi d^2

The side length of the square is twice the radius of the semi circle. So the side length of the square is 2d units.

Area of the square is,


=(2d)^2\\\\=4d^2

The total area will be,


=2\pi d^2+4d^2

So that the random point will be in the shaded region is,


=\frac{\text{Area of semi circles}}{\text{Area of square}}


=(2\pi d^2)/(2\pi d^2+4d^2)


=(2\pi)/(2\pi+4)


=0.6


=60\%
